Outsider sources
Josephus (37/38 -100 A.C.E.) Antiquities of the Jews (3 short references)
Josephus Testimonium Flavianum – devotes a full paragraph to Jesus.
Babylonian Talmud (2nd Century)
Seutonius (2nd Century)
Pliny the Younger (2nd Century)
Tacitus ((2nd Century)
Lucian of Samosata (ca. 120-180)
Insider Sources
Sources like the Gospels: Mathew, Mark, Luke, John
Points of convergence from outside sources
There is the appearance of the title Christos as a virtual name (Josephus, Suetonius, Tacitus, Pliny)
His location in Palestine/ Judaea (Josephus, Tacitus, Lucian)
His death by execution (Josephus, Tacitus, Lucian)
The continued presence of a movement carrying his name (Josephus, Suetonius, Tacitus, Pliny, Lucian).
Less well attested historical events attested by outside sources concerning his death
Placement of his death under Pontius Pilate (Tacitus, Josephus)
Placement of his death under Tiberius (Tacitus)
Involvement of Jewish leaders in his death (Josephus)
Who attested Jesus was a teacher?
Josephus and Lucian
Who attested that Jesus worked wonders?
Josephus
Who thouight it was a depraved “superstition”
Suetonius, Tacitus, Pliny
